How do I adjust audio fade-in and fade-out?

  • How do I cancel audio fade-in and fade-out?


    I can't hear the beginning of my voiceover.

  • To prevent fade out, add longer animation or pause time to the final element so that the video length is at least  a few seconds longer than the audio length.
